Turkey - Paper workers strike for bargaining agreement - September 30, 2024

Workers at MKB Corrugated Box and Packaging downed their tools, demanding that the company sign a collective agreement. Union Seluloz-Is has been working to secure fair conditions for the employees at MKB Rondo since they established a presence there two years ago. However, due legal complexities, collective bargaining only commenced at the beginning of 2024. After eight months of negotiations with progress on several fronts, three key issues remain unresolved: wage increases, with the union demanding 80% and the employer offering 45%; the establishment of a workplace disciplinary board; and the appointment of a workplace union representative, to which the employer has yet to respond.
